Hey guys,

I'm new to cpap, been using the S9 Elite for a few weeks, I was checking out my data on rescan but can't seem to get a look at the detailed graphs, only the summery graphs (says no detailed data available). I was wondering is this because my machine does not support this function or have I not activated a function.

Neither -- as far as the machine is concerned. Your machine always, records all the data.

When the download screen opens, click on the Select button, and then make sure you select a download of the details in addition to the summary. Try to ask for 5 sessions data, so you'll get at least a few days of historical detailed data too. When the program asks whether to overwrited existing data, say yes.

You'll only get detailed data for a few days back -- but that''s better than none!
